中山市网站建设_网站建设公司_加载速度优化_seo优化
2026/3/2 21:30:55 网站建设 项目流程

3大绝招:OpenCode终端AI编程助手的完全使用指南

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

想要在终端中享受AI编程的便利吗?OpenCode作为一款专为终端设计的开源AI编程助手,正在改变开发者的工作方式。无论你是新手还是资深开发者,掌握这款工具都能大幅提升编程效率。本文将为你详细介绍OpenCode的核心功能和使用技巧,帮助你快速上手这个强大的AI编程伙伴。💻

快速上手:安装与环境配置

选择最适合的安装方式

根据你的操作系统和偏好,OpenCode提供了多种安装方案:

macOS用户:推荐使用Homebrew一键安装

brew install sst/tap/opencode

跨平台用户:使用官方安装脚本

curl -fsSL https://opencode.ai/install | bash

Node.js开发者:通过npm全局安装

npm i -g opencode-ai@latest

安装完成后,通过简单的版本检查确认安装成功:

opencode --version

环境变量配置技巧

如果遇到命令未找到的情况,别担心!只需按照以下步骤配置环境变量:

Bash或Zsh用户

echo 'export PATH="$HOME/.opencode/bin:$PATH"' >> ~/.bashrc source ~/.bashrc

Fish Shell用户

fish_add_path $HOME/.opencode/bin

核心功能深度体验

终端交互:最直接的AI编程体验

在终端中输入opencode命令,你将进入一个功能强大的AI编程环境。这个界面展示了OpenCode的独特优势:

  • 实时代码分析:AI能够理解你当前编辑的代码文件,提供精准的建议
  • 智能修改推荐:如示例中Button组件属性的优化建议
  • 清晰的代码变更对比,让你一目了然地看到修改效果

IDE集成:无缝的开发体验

OpenCode与主流IDE的深度整合是其另一大亮点。在VS Code环境中,你可以:

  • 无缝协作:AI助手面板与代码编辑器完美配合
  • 项目感知:工具能够访问完整的项目结构和代码文件
  • 支持多种AI模型,包括Claude、GPT和Gemini等

实际应用场景全解析

代码调试:快速定位问题

遇到棘手的bug?OpenCode能够帮你:

  1. 详细描述遇到的具体问题现象
  2. 提供相关的代码片段和错误信息
  3. AI会分析问题并提供具体的修复方案

实用案例

  • 内存泄漏问题诊断
  • 性能瓶颈分析
  • 逻辑错误排查

功能开发:高效的代码生成

需要实现新功能时,OpenCode能够:

  • 根据功能描述生成完整的代码实现
  • 提供多种实现方案供你选择
  • 自动生成配套的测试代码和文档

性能优化与使用技巧

模型选择:找到最适合的AI伙伴

不同AI模型在性能和成本上有所差异:

  • Claude模型:擅长复杂逻辑推理和代码理解
  • GPT模型:在创意性代码生成方面表现出色
  • Gemini模型:在某些特定领域的优化效果突出

网络配置:确保稳定连接

对于网络连接问题,建议:

  • 检查代理设置是否正确
  • 确保能够正常访问AI服务API
  • 考虑使用本地部署方案

常见问题解决方案

命令执行失败

症状:输入opencode命令后提示"command not found"

解决方案

  • 检查环境变量配置
  • 确认$HOME/.opencode/bin路径已添加到PATH中

AI响应缓慢

症状:等待AI响应时间过长

解决方案

  • 尝试切换到不同的AI模型
  • 检查网络连接质量
  • 考虑使用性能更强的模型版本

版本管理与升级策略

保持OpenCode最新版本可以获得更好的性能和功能支持:

Homebrew用户

brew upgrade opencode

npm用户

npm update -g opencode-ai

最佳实践指南

项目结构优化

为了获得更好的AI辅助效果:

  1. 保持清晰的目录结构:便于AI理解和分析代码
  2. 使用规范的命名约定:让AI更容易识别文件功能
  3. 编写详细的代码注释:帮助AI准确理解你的编程意图

渐进式集成策略

建议从简单任务开始,逐步过渡到复杂功能:

  • 第一步:尝试代码格式化和简单修改
  • 第二步:进行代码重构和优化
  • 第三步:实现复杂功能和算法

通过本指南的学习,你已经掌握了OpenCode的核心功能和使用技巧。现在,你可以在自己的开发环境中实践这些知识,体验AI编程带来的效率革命。记住,熟练掌握任何工具都需要时间和实践,保持耐心,你将成为AI编程的高手!🚀

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询